This winter season, you can take in the excellent urban areas of Moscow and St. Petersburg as well as exploring deep into the Russian and Norwegian Arctic Circle in a quest for the eminent Aurora Borealis (Northern Lights). Prestigious for its showy scenes and sensational atmosphere, the Arctic Circle is one of the world’s most […]